Abstract

The invention discloses an air conditioner and an energy efficiency calculating method thereof. The method comprises the following steps: present working conditions of the air conditioner, the power of a compressor and the power consumption of the air conditioner are obtained; a high-pressure side pressure of an exhaust port of the compressor, a temperature t1 of an air return port in the compressor, a temperature t2 of the exhaust port in the compressor, a temperature t4 of a first end of an outdoor heat exchanger and a temperature t7 of a first end of an indoor heat exchanger are obtained; when the present working conditions of the air conditioner are refrigeration working conditions, a refrigerant enthalpy value h1 of the air return port, a refrigerant enthalpy value h2 of the exhaust port, a refrigerant enthalpy value h4 of the first end of the outdoor heat exchanger and a refrigerant enthalpy value h7 of the first end of the indoor heat exchanger are respectively generated according to t1, t2, the high-pressure side pressure, t4 and t7; the refrigeration capacity of the air conditioner is generated according to the power of the compressor, h1, h2, h4 and h7; and the energy efficiency of the air conditioner is generated according to the power consumption and the refrigeration capacity of the air conditioner, so that the real-time accurate detection of the energy efficiency of the air conditioner in realized.

Description

technical field [0001] The invention relates to the technical field of air conditioners, in particular to an air conditioner energy efficiency calculation method and an air conditioner. Background technique [0002] As the country pays more and more attention to energy saving, consumers have higher and higher requirements for energy saving and comfort of air conditioners. At present, during the operation of the air conditioner, since it is impossible to detect the change of the energy efficiency of the air conditioner in real time, it is difficult for the air conditioner to maintain a good operating state, resulting in unsatisfactory cooling, heating effects and energy-saving performance.
